Original Description
Jean-Baptiste Robie’s Etude De Fruits is a captivating celebration of abundance and natural beauty, embodying the lush elegance of 19th-century still-life painting. Robie, a Belgian master renowned for his sumptuous depictions of fruit and flowers, infuses the canvas with vibrant textures—glossy grapes, velvety peaches, and dewy foliage—that seem almost tangible. The composition exudes warmth and opulence, inviting viewers to savor the richness of each meticulously rendered detail. Painted during Europe’s Romantic period, Robie’s work reflects both the enduring Dutch Golden Age influence and the era’s fascination with sensory delight. While lesser-known than his contemporaries, Robie’s Etude De Fruits occupies a distinctive niche in art history, bridging academic precision with lyrical charm, making it a treasured example of Romantic-era still life.
